The next (second) political consultations between the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Azerbaijan and the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Uruguay were held on May 11, 2022, in Montevideo, the capital of Uruguay, the press service of Azerbaijani MFA told APA.

The delegations were led by Azerbaijani Deputy Foreign Minister Elnur Mammadov and Uruguay's Deputy Foreign Minister Carolina Ache Batlle.

The current state of bilateral relations, as well as the expansion of cooperation in political, economic, agricultural, transport, energy and humanitarian spheres were discussed during the political consultations.

Deputy Minister E.Mammadov briefed the other side on the new political realities in the region after the Great Patriotic War, the measures taken by Azerbaijan and large-scale projects on the restoration and construction work in our liberated territories, stressed the importance of international transport corridors passing through the territory of Azerbaijan in terms of increasing trade relations between the Far East, Central Asia and Europe.

The parties also exchanged views on the development of prospects for cooperation within regional and international organizations.

On the same day, Deputy Foreign Minister Elnur Mammadov met with members of the Uruguay-Azerbaijan friendship group of the Foreign Relations Commission of the House of Representatives of the Uruguayan Parliament.

During the meeting, the sides exchanged views on the expansion of inter-parliamentary relations, the development of bilateral cooperation, the ongoing processes in the South Caucasus region, and other issues of mutual interest.
